Teriyaki Beef Stir Fry

I’ve been into simple and fast lately; this recipe qualifies in both.  Oh and it’s healthy too. I hope you like it.
12 oz ribeye steak
1  green bell pepper, diced
1 red bell pepper, diced
1/2 red onion, diced
1/2 cup broccoli, chopped in bite size pieces
1/2 cup sugar snap peas
3 cloves, diced
4 tablespoons teriyaki
3 oz red wine
3 tablespoons corn starch
4 tablespoons water
Oil for cooking.
Cut beef into bite size pieces
In a bowl add beef, wine, and teriyaki; let marinate for 10 minutes
Heat wok to medium high
Add oil
Add vegetables and stir fry for 4 minutes, stirring constantly
Add garlic
Make a well in the bottom and add beef with liquid
Mix water and corn starch and stir until smooth
Stir everything in wok until beef is browned
Add cornstarch mixture
Let mixture thicken while stirring
Serve over rice
